11. Evil Dead II
We all love Evil Dead II very much, but man, it is barmy as hell!
To start with, it changes the whole vibe. The first Evil Dead was a straight horror while this follow-up is very much a horror-comedy, and it's also essentially a remake as well as a sequel. The first quarter-hour retells the events of the first film, but with only two of the characters present, and once Ash (Bruce Campbell) is left alone, he is forced to fight a series of bizarre foes.
These include wacky demons brought-to-life with glorious stop-motion that'd make Ray Harryhausen proud, a severed head, that same head's corpse wielding a chainsaw, and even Ash's own possessed hand, which he is forced to cut off. He then attaches a chainsaw to his stump and goes to bat once more.
These deranged set-pieces, directed with manic brilliance by Sam Raimi, make the whole thing even more in-your-face bats**t crazy. Mad to the end, it eventually finishes with Ash being sucked into a portal and landing in the Middle Ages, setting the stage for another wacky installment, which would be 1992's Army of Darkness.
